This is a $14.85 a year subscription based extension which blocks / hides / closes many kinds of annoyances usually not covered by ad blockers: newsletter pop-ups, chat boxes, survey/opinion pop-ups, "Allow notifications" pop-ups and many others.

What is No, thanks.?

No, thanks. is a $14.85 a year subscription based Firefox add-on that blocks and hides various annoyances such as newsletter pop-ups, chat boxes, survey pop-ups, and more. Clean your screen space!
